Challenges with Limited Visibility
Truck-mounted cranes face several challenges when it comes to visibility. One of the main challenges is the size and configuration of the crane itself. The boom, jib, and counterweight of the crane can obstruct the operator's view, creating blind spots around the crane. In addition, the height of the crane can make it challenging for the operator to see objects on the ground or at lower levels.
Another challenge is the positioning of the crane during operation. The operator needs to have a clear view of the load being lifted, as well as the area where the load will be placed. Limited visibility can make it difficult for the operator to position the crane accurately, increasing the risk of accidents or damage to the load or surrounding structures.
Furthermore, environmental factors such as poor lighting, adverse weather conditions, or dust and debris can further reduce visibility for the operator. 1. Cameras and Monitoring Systems
One of the most common solutions for enhancing visibility on truck-mounted cranes is the use of cameras and monitoring systems. Cameras can be mounted on various parts of the crane, such as the boom, jib, or counterweight, to provide the operator with a live feed of the crane's surroundings. Monitoring systems can display multiple camera feeds on a screen inside the crane cab, giving the operator a comprehensive view of the area around the crane.
These camera systems can help eliminate blind spots and provide the operator with a clear view of obstacles, workers, or equipment in close proximity to the crane. Some advanced camera systems also come with features such as zoom capabilities, night vision, and object detection, further enhancing visibility for the operator. By using cameras and monitoring systems, operators can make more informed decisions and operate the crane safely and efficiently.
2. Proximity Sensors and Alarms
Proximity sensors and alarms are another effective solution for enhancing visibility on truck-mounted cranes. These sensors can detect objects or individuals in the crane's path and alert the operator through visual or auditory alarms. Proximity sensors can be installed on the crane's boom, jib, or chassis to provide 360-degree coverage and help prevent collisions with nearby obstacles.
When an object is detected within a certain distance from the crane, the proximity sensor triggers an alarm to warn the operator to stop or maneuver the crane to avoid a potential collision. Some proximity sensors can also be integrated with the crane's hydraulic system to automatically slow down or stop the crane's movement when an obstacle is detected, adding an extra layer of safety for crane operations.
3. High-Visibility Markings and Lighting
Improving the visibility of truck-mounted cranes can also be achieved through the use of high-visibility markings and lighting. Reflective decals, tape, or paint can be applied to the crane's structure to make it more visible in low-light conditions or at night. High-visibility colors such as yellow, orange, or red can help the crane stand out against the surrounding environment and make it easier for others to see the crane from a distance.
In addition to markings, lighting plays a crucial role in enhancing visibility for truck-mounted cranes. High-intensity LED lights can be installed on the crane's boom, jib, or chassis to illuminate the work area and improve visibility for the operator. These lights can be adjusted to provide focused illumination on the load or the area where the load will be placed, helping the operator work more effectively in dimly lit conditions.
4. Operator Training and Best Practices
While technology and design improvements are essential for enhancing visibility on truck-mounted cranes, operator training and best practices also play a vital role in ensuring safe and efficient crane operations. Operators should be trained on how to use the crane's controls, how to maneuver the crane in tight spaces, and how to maintain situational awareness while operating the crane.
Emphasizing the importance of communication between the operator and ground personnel is crucial for enhancing visibility and safety on construction sites or other work environments. Spotters can assist the operator by providing guidance on blind spots, obstacles, or other hazards that may not be visible from the crane cab. By following best practices and protocols for crane operations, operators can minimize the risks associated with limited visibility and ensure smooth and safe crane operations.
